Installation and ease of use
Bottled loading water dispenser:
One of the biggest advantages of bottled loading water dispensers is that they are very easy to install. Users only need to buy a loading water dispenser and replace the water bucket regularly, without complicated installation or pipe connection. Even if you are a resident of a rented house, you don't need to worry about modifying the water pipes or other tedious installation work when using a bottled loading water dispenser. As long as there is power, the bottled loading water dispenser can be used, which is very suitable for occasions that require flexible water use.
Direct drinking water system:
The direct drinking water system needs to be connected to the tap water pipeline and professionally installed. This may not only require changes to the existing water pipe structure, but also may require water quality issues, such as adding a filter device. Therefore, the installation of the direct drinking water system is relatively complicated, and once installed, it is not as flexible as a bottled loading water dispenser.

Cost considerations
Barreled loading water dispensers:
The cost of bottled loading water dispensers is relatively low. Although there is a one-time investment in purchasing a loading water dispenser itself, the daily expenses are mainly the purchase of water barrels, and the price is relatively fixed and transparent. The monthly water bill expenditure is controllable, and there is no need for additional pipe modification and long-term maintenance costs. For some families or offices with small water consumption or temporary use, the initial cost and operating cost of bottled loading water dispensers are relatively economical.
Direct drinking water system:
The initial installation cost of the direct drinking water system is high because it requires professional water pipe modification and high-quality filtering equipment. The installation of these devices requires additional labor and material costs. In addition, filters and pipes need to be replaced and cleaned regularly, so the long-term maintenance cost is relatively high. Although the direct drinking water system may be more economical than bottled water in the long run, the initial investment and maintenance costs may be a consideration for households or small offices that do not need large-scale use.

Ease of maintenance
Barreled loading water dispensers:
Barreled loading water dispensers are relatively simple to maintain. Users only need to replace the water bucket regularly and clean the outside and inside of the dispenser. Cleaning generally does not require complex tools, and barreled loading water dispensers usually do not have problems such as pipe blockage. The difficulty of maintenance and servicing is relatively low, and no professional personnel are required to handle it.
Direct drinking water system:
The maintenance of the direct drinking water system is more complicated. In addition to the need to replace the filter regularly, the pipes in the system also need to be cleaned and inspected regularly. If the system fails, it may be necessary to ask professional maintenance personnel to inspect and repair it, which increases the difficulty and cost of maintenance. In addition, when used for a long time, due to the accumulation of scale and impurities in the pipes, more cleaning and maintenance work may be required.
